The 46th Annual Community Celebrated Event Returns to the Plaza. Celebrated around the world, Las Posadas recreates Mary and Joseph’s search for a place of shelter in the days leading up to the birth of Jesus. This historic Hispanic version is presented by local volunteers and others from from several northern New Mexico communities. The candle-lit procession will begin at 5:30pm on the Santa Fe Plaza and conclude with carols, and good cheer. The History Museum will close at 3pm to prepare for this free public event.
